Skip to content
View JonasFarias93's full-sized avatar

Block or report JonasFarias93

Block user

Prevent this user from interacting with your repositories and sending you notifications. Learn more about blocking users.

You must be logged in to block users.

Maximum 250 characters. Please don’t include any personal information such as legal names or email addresses. Markdown is supported. This note will only be visible to you.
Report abuse

Contact GitHub support about this user’s behavior. Learn more about reporting abuse.

Report abuse
JonasFarias93/README.md

Portfolio LinkedIn


👋 Olá, eu sou Jonas Farias

Engenharia de Software • Sistemas Corporativos & Automação de Infraestrutura • Python & Django

Construo sistemas com foco em domínio, arquitetura limpa e rastreabilidade de decisões.
Gosto de transformar problemas reais em software sustentável: testável, evolutivo e pronto para produção.


🧭 Foco atual

  • Backend com Python/Django
  • Sistemas corporativos, automação e integrações
  • Infraestrutura, Linux e automação de operação em ambiente real de produção
  • Qualidade: testes, arquitetura, boas práticas e consistência de design

⚙️ Como eu trabalho

  • Toda alteração destrutiva tem backup e rollback — se um script falha no meio do caminho, o ambiente volta ao estado anterior sozinho.
  • Prefiro eliminar uma dependência frágil a documentá-la — se algo pode não estar disponível no ambiente de destino (internet, uma lib, uma versão), busco uma solução que não dependa disso.
  • Decisões técnicas ficam registradas, não só no código — arquitetura, trade-offs e o "porquê" de uma escolha importam tanto quanto o "como".

📊 Em produção

Atuo na área de Rollout e Equipamentos do Grupo RD (Drogasil, Droga Raia) — maior rede de farmácias do Brasil.

  • Scripts de provisionamento usados na abertura de 350+ novas filiais em 2026
  • Mais de 11.000 equipamentos passaram pelo fluxo de automação em 2025 — PDVs, TCs, consulta de preço, impressoras de oferta e tablets
  • Rollout de 1.000+ lojas previsto para 2026, com produção contínua
  • Adotado por outras equipes (abertura de loja), além do time de rollout/equipamentos

🧩 Projetos em destaque

  • expansao360 ⭐ Plataforma de gestão de expansão e operação de campo, com separação rigorosa entre Cadastro Mestre e Execução Operacional — histórico imutável, gates de governança e rastreabilidade de ponta a ponta → Python • Django • PostgreSQL • Clean Architecture • DDD • ADRs

  • infra-automation ⚙️ Scripts de automação para ambientes de produção real: provisionamento offline de máquinas, sincronização de dados e padronização de processos operacionais — nascidos de problemas reais de campo, não de exercícios → Python • Bash • Linux • SQLite • Automação offline

  • personal-dev-handbook 📖 Sistema pessoal de engenharia: padrões de arquitetura, Python, Django, Docker, Git e segurança, validados na prática e usados como base para iniciar novos projetos com consistência → Python • Django • Docker • Git • CI • Security

  • dev-templates 🧱 Templates de projeto com estrutura, ambiente e layout de terminal (Zellij) prontos — acionados pelo comando new-project dos meus dotfiles, do zero ao ambiente configurado em segundos → Bash • Conda • Zellij • Automação de produtividade


🛠️ Stack principal


"Código bom não é o que funciona em teoria. É o que continua funcionando em produção."

Pinned Loading

  1. expansao360 expansao360 Public

    Sistema de gestão operacional para expansão e rastreabilidade (Registry + Operation). Python/Django, Clean Architecture, TDD e CLI.

    Python 1

  2. personal-dev-handbook personal-dev-handbook Public

    Manual pessoal de desenvolvimento: padrões de design, processos de Git/GitHub e referências de engenharia de software focadas em manutenibilidade e testes."

  3. dev-templates dev-templates Public

    Shell 1

  4. infra-automation infra-automation Public

    Coleção de scripts de automação de infraestrutura e operação, criados para resolver problemas reais do dia a dia — provisionamento de máquinas, sincronização de dados, coleta de inventário, e outra…

    Python 1